The Global Process Oils Market, estimated at USD 7.2 billion in 2025, is projected to reach 12.7 billion by 2034, growing at a CAGR of 6.5%.The process oil market is a critical component of various industries, serving as essential raw materials in the production of a wide range of products including rubber, lubricants, coatings, and plastics. Process oils are derived from crude oil and are primarily used as additives or base oils to improve the performance and processing of these products. Their application spans across numerous industries such as automotive, textiles, food and beverage, and cosmetics. The market for process oils is heavily driven by the increasing demand for advanced, high-quality products that require specialized oils for enhanced performance and durability. As industries continue to innovate, there is a growing trend towards process oils that are not only effective but also environmentally friendly, contributing to sustainability goals. Furthermore, the demand for high-performance oils that support automotive and industrial machinery functions is anticipated to drive significant growth in the process oil market. As global industrial activities expand, especially in emerging economies, the need for quality process oils is set to increase, establishing process oils as indispensable in the manufacturing landscape.
